Most people experience no warning to their attacks and since the root cause eludes most sufferers, you need to have a look at the common anxiety attack symptoms in order to identify whether or not you have the disorder. Here is what to look for:
· Heart palpitations or rapid heart rate
· Shortness of breath
· Hot flashes or chills
· Sweating
· The feeling of choking
· Tingling or a feeling of numbness
· Shaking
· Chest pains or the feeling of a heart attack
· Stomach ache or pains and/or nausea
· Dizziness, lightheaded, or feeling you might pass out
· Feeling like you're losing control or you might go crazy
· Feeling detached from reality
· Feeling like you're going to die
· Overwhelming fear of a panic attack
The symptoms of panic disorder are often similar to those of a heart attack and can last between anywhere from a few seconds to a few minutes.
